Millotia dimorpha P.S.Short

Reference
Austral.Syst.Bot. 8:13-14 (1995)
Conservation Code
Priority One
Naturalised Status
Native to Western Australia
Name Status
Current

Erect or ascending annual, herb, ca 0.11 m high. Fl. yellow-white, Sep. Red loamy soils.

Amanda Spooner, Descriptive Catalogue, 16 May 1997

Distribution

IBRA Regions
Avon Wheatbelt, Yalgoo.
IBRA Subregions
Merredin, Tallering.
Local Government Areas (LGAs)
Morawa, Perenjori.
